In order to deal with the requirements demanded by next-generation diagnostic markets, several of the essential features of LFAs have to be boosted. Initially, assays require to be a lot more reproducible and sensitive, less complicated to produce as well as operate, as well as most notably from a medical point of view, they need to provide pertinent results that correlate with other laboratory-based analysis systems. Automation of the manufacturing procedure and sample application, in addition to enhanced read-out as well as information handling, are required to accomplish these goals. Moreover, material scientific research should be related to bring unique better suited custom-designed products into usage, along with the intro of brand-new labelling and analysis technologies. Using brand-new tags such as quantum dots and also the upconverting phosphors will boost sensitivity, enabling the use of examples with lower concentrations of the analyte such as sweat or salvia. In the Western globe, assimilation of LFA into a lab-on-a-chip layout may bring additional benefits, yet will certainly additionally enhance expenses.

Nucleic acid-based LFAs utilizing nucleic acid hybridization or amplification methods are additionally developed for Salmonella. However, additional speculative steps consisting of nucleic acid or genomic DNA seclusion, guide style, as well as PCR are required. Because of the poorly suited point-of-care testing of PCR, new methods such as isothermal amplification ended up being prominent. Utilizing this kind of LFAs, lower discovery restriction of Salmonellasuch as 20 fg of target DNA or 1.05 × 101cfu of microorganisms in pure culture or 1.3-- 1.9 cfu/g or 1.3-- 1.9 cfu/mL of Salmonellain infected poultry items can be attained after enrichment. The assay level of sensitivity may also reveal range according to the length of amplicon or target. The typically made use of reagents in this assay are biotin/fluorescein, biotin/digoxigenin tags for amplicons and gold/anti-digoxin Abdominal or gold/streptavidin conjugate on conjugate pad. Depending upon the debilitated capture representatives such as Abs, labeled nucleic acids, or aptamers on examination as well as control line, assay is performed and results ended up being visible for Salmonella.

The membrane layer utilized in an LFIA influences sensitivity, speed as well as general history (Huang et al., 2016 and also Wild & Mansfield, 2016). Faster flow rates can minimize history, however can jeopardize level of sensitivity, leading to false downsides. Slower wicking rates are manipulated when high sensitivity is required because analyte resident time is boosted. Slow-moving wicking prices can create false-positive signals due to higher histories brought on by antibodies that are not appropriately certain.
